Import your DNSPod domains in under a minute

No API setup, no OAuth dance. Copy from your DNSPod portal, paste into Lemon, done.

Open your DNSPod console
  1. 1Open your DNSPod account at dnspod.com and go to the domain list.
  2. 2If the list paginates, switch to "show all" or the largest page size so every DNSPod domain is visible.
  3. 3Copy the visible list, or export to CSV if DNSPod offers it from the account area.
  4. 4In Lemon Domains, click Import, paste the list or upload the CSV, and map the columns. Lemon previews everything before it commits.
  5. 5Tag the registrar account with a friendly label (for example "DNSPod personal" or "DNSPod client work") so sub-accounts stay distinct.

DNSPod + Lemon Domains FAQ

Does Lemon Domains support DNSPod domains?

Yes. DNSPod domains can be imported into Lemon Domains by pasting your domain list from the DNSPod dashboard or by uploading a CSV export. Multiple DNSPod accounts are supported with friendly labels so sub-accounts stay distinct in the unified portfolio.

How is this different from the DNSPod dashboard?

DNSPod has been registering domains since 2006 with around 3 million domains under management, but its built-in dashboard is account-scoped and not designed for portfolio thinking. Lemon Domains pulls every DNSPod domain into one searchable, sortable list, adds live expiry countdowns, 30/60/90 day grouping, and project folders, and unifies DNSPod with every other registrar you use.

Do I need to share my DNSPod password?

No. Lemon never asks for your DNSPod password. The simplest flow is to paste a copy of your portfolio list from DNSPod into Lemon, or upload a CSV exported from the DNSPod dashboard. Neither needs your password.

Can I track multiple DNSPod accounts?

Yes. Add one Lemon Domains registrar entry per DNSPod account with its own friendly label. Personal and business logins, sub-accounts, and client accounts all sit side by side in one dashboard.

Does Lemon Domains renew my DNSPod domains?

No. Renewal still happens at DNSPod. Lemon Domains tracks expiry dates and auto-renew status so you know exactly when to act, but the renewal button stays at DNSPod.
